In order to solve the following system of equations by addition, which of the

following could you do before adding the equations so that one variable will
minated when you add them?
4x - 2y=7
3x - 3y=15

Explanation:

You could multiply the first equation by 3 and the second one by -2 so that the 2 y terms would be -6y and 6y:

12x - 6y = 21

-6x + 6y = -30

Adding these will eliminate the y variable.
